There are approximately 99,000 people currently living in Great Yarmouth. The most prevalent age group in the population is over 60 years old. Unemployment affects 4% of the UK population. With a rate of 3.8%, unemployment in this area is in line with the national average. The economically active population amounts to 44,700 people, making up 75.3% of the population. With an average gross annual income of £23,743, salaries in Great Yarmouth are lower than the average salary of just over £30,500 across the UK.

Crepe Delicious operates in the Takeaway services sector. There are 25 locations open so far, and the network is expanding. You will need an initial investment of £80,000 to open your own Crepe Delicious business. Your personal investment should account for at least £50,000 of the total amount. Another option to consider is Bubbleology, a brand that first began operating in 2015. This brand is developing quickly, counting 69 outlets across the UK. Starting a Bubbleology business requires a significant initial investment of £120,000. If you intend to get a loan to cover the startup costs, Bubbleology asks for a personal investment of at least £36,000. For most franchises, this amount represents 30 to 50% of the total investment.
